Abstract

The human body has the ability to prevent and correct endothelial dysfunction by producing antioxidants. This primary antioxidant will help prevent oxidation caused by free radicals, so the blood vessels endothelial dysfunction and will not experience does not occur in atherosclerotic arteries. Under these circumstances, where the number of free radicals in the blood is very excessive, an antioxidant that is produced by the body no longer effective, so that the necessary antioxidants from the outside (secondary). This research experiments, using post test only control group design. Statistical analysis is used for the T test, to assess the effect of antioxidants (curcumin). From the results of this study proves that there is a positive influence, that curcumin can prevent endothelial cell dysfunction with no incidence of characteristics of foam cells in the aorta of male teenagers who typhoid chronic alcohol exposure. Suggestion is to increase the consumption antiokidan (curcumin) to improve vascular endothelial damage (sclerosis).   Keywords : Exposure to alcohol, the aortic endothelial dysfunction, provision of curcumin

Abstract

Increase systolic blood pressure that related with impairedvasodilatation of the arterioles is affected by the decrease of NO level andincrease peroxynitrite. Nitric oxide level may be reduced by increase ofSuperoxide production that due to alcohol consumption. Superoxidedismutase activity will be decreased by its role in preventing reaction ofSuperoxide with NO to form peroxynitrite. Superoxide is reduced by SODto form hydrogen peroxide and oxygen. Oxidative stress due to alcoholconsumption lead to lower NO level and SOD activity in the blood. Theaims of this study are to examine the influence of rosela tea to the SODlevels in blood serum in rats given doses of alcohol 30 % 3 g / kg bodyweight / day.Thirty male of Wistar rats with weight 150 grams were divided intofive groups, each group consists of 6 animals. Group A was controlgroup. Group B was given by alcohol. Group C, D, E were given byalcohol and rosela. Doses 0.75 gram of dried rosela that diluted by 200cc of water gave to group C, while group D was given by rosela dose 1.5grams and 3 grams to E group. Providing alcohol and rosela conductedover 28 days by orally (orogastric tube). Rosela was given at 08.00 amand alcohol at 10:00 am. SOD levels in blood are measured aftertreatment. Results showed that Superoxide dismutase levels of groupthat were given by alcohol and 0.75 g, 1.5 g, 3 g rosela higher than thosein group that received only alcohol and control. Conclussion, rats thatwere given by rosela tea and alcohol have higher SOD level compared tocontrol group.Keywords : alcohol, rosela, Nitric oxide, SOD
